Oleg Andrejev is a scholar working on Oceanography, Atmospheric Science and Pollution. According to data from OpenAlex, Oleg Andrejev has authored 17 papers receiving a total of 388 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 11 papers in Oceanography, 5 papers in Atmospheric Science and 4 papers in Pollution. Recurrent topics in Oleg Andrejev's work include Oceanographic and Atmospheric Processes (11 papers), Marine and coastal ecosystems (5 papers) and Oil Spill Detection and Mitigation (4 papers). Oleg Andrejev is often cited by papers focused on Oceanographic and Atmospheric Processes (11 papers), Marine and coastal ecosystems (5 papers) and Oil Spill Detection and Mitigation (4 papers). Oleg Andrejev collaborates with scholars based in Sweden, Finland and Estonia. Oleg Andrejev's co-authors include Kai Myrberg, Tarmo Soomere, Peter Lundberg, Alexander Sokolov, Kristofer Döös, Anton Sokolov, Andreas Lehmann, H. Lauri, Miguel Medina and Thomas R. Anderson and has published in prestigious journals such as Marine Pollution Bulletin, Estuarine Coastal and Shelf Science and AMBIO.
